ICYMI: All aboard the world's largest boat elevator

China’s elevator beats the lock system any day.

Today on In Case You Missed It: The Three Gorges Dam in China is home to the largest ship elevator, hauling up to 3000 tons of cargo from one lower level of water to the higher stream at the top. Meanwhile, Georgia Tech engineers believe their new fabric, which can harvest energy from both movement and the sun, will revolutionize how we keep devices charged.

The three baby parent video is here, and the crystallizing salts are here. As always, please share any interesting tech or science videos you find by using the #ICYMI hashtag on Twitter for @mskerryd.

